The body collar adjustment screw (#10641) has

been adjusted to seat the 1 1/8 oz (WAA-12) plastic

wad into the hull. The shot dispenser bellcrank makes

a complete stroke and dispenses one charge of shot

wile the wad is being seated into the hull. Fig 23B

Turning the body collar adjustment screw

(#10641) clockwise (too high) will raise the shot

dispenser, reducing the amount the wad is seated into

the hull and may result in an incomplete stroke of the

bellcrank.

Station Four – The starter crimp die (#10640)

forms and folds the loaded shotshell hull. This die is

set for Winchester AA hulls so we achieve 60%

closure of the top.

Fig. 24

Station Five – Here we’ll finish crimp and seat. A

final seat plug presses the hull back down and below

the top by approximately 1/16 of an inch. The taper

crimp feature within the die radiuses and blends the

end of the hull and locks the crimp on the hull. It too

is adjusted for Winchester AA hulls. Fig. 25
